TWO AIMS

This course consist of two parts. In part one we will teach you process mapping /flowcharting so you can visualize a process. In the second part we will teach you process improvement techniques. We will teach you how to speed up a process, make a process more efficient, visualize and calculate this process efficiency and deal with risks in your process.

PROCESS MAPPING

In project management or business analysis, the ability to create process maps (also known as flowcharts) is considered to be a very important key skill for the business analyst aiming for process improvement. Those who master the skill of process mapping or flowcharting and can make a process map, can play a key role in projects by creating, manipulating and interpreting processes by means of process mapping / flowcharting.

PROCESS  This course does not only teach you process mapping, but also teaches you how to use the process flowcharts and use them as a basis for process improvement. We teach you how to make the process more efficient.

Map a Simple Personal Process
Mapping a simple personal process, such as your morning routine or grocery shopping, will provide hands-on experience with process mapping techniques.
Show steps
  • Choose a simple personal process.
  • Identify the steps involved in the process.
  • Create a flowchart of the process.
  • Analyze the flowchart for potential improvements.

Develop a Risk Assessment for a Process
Developing a risk assessment for a process will help you understand how to identify and mitigate potential risks in process improvement initiatives.
Show steps
  • Choose a process to assess.
  • Identify potential risks in the process.
  • Assess the likelihood and impact of each risk.
  • Develop mitigation strategies for each risk.
  • Document the risk assessment in a report.
